The Itinerary Breakdown
Start at The Driskill Bar
Your night begins at this famously haunted hotel, the Driskill. It’s an iconic Austin landmark, once home to tragedy and reportedly haunted by spirits like the “Lady in White” and the “Man with the Cigar.” The tour kicks off with a drink and some intriguing ghost stories in a setting that’s steeped in history. Expect about 20 minutes here, giving you time to soak in the atmosphere and maybe get a photo or two. From reviews, we know that the guide, Esteban, makes this part especially engaging — he’s praised for his enthusiasm and depth of knowledge.
Next stop: Casino El Camino
Originally a beer joint, now a popular burger spot, Casino El Camino sits in a building with a haunted past — a former boarding house. Here, you’ll learn about Mary, a ghost said to haunt the place, and enjoy a Bloody Mary or a burger if you’re hungry. This stop also lasts roughly 20 minutes, giving you enough time to chat with your guide and soak in the building’s spooky vibe. The tour’s flexibility allows you to order drinks and just relax, which many reviews highlight as a plus.
The Museum of the Weird
While not a bar, this museum is a highlight for fans of oddities and the bizarre. It’s packed with unusual artifacts, from remnants of Austin’s above-ground burials to the “Minnesota Iceman.” The stop lasts about 20 minutes, and although it’s not an official haunted site, its weird collection adds a fun, unexpected twist to the evening. It’s a great way to break up the pub stops and get a taste of Austin’s quirky side.
Maggie Mae’s
Named after a woman in Liverpool, this bar has its own sordid history. The guide shares the story of the original Maggie Mae, adding a touch of international intrigue. Located on East 6th Street — the city’s lively nightlife corridor — it’s a lively, historic spot. Expect about 20 minutes here, enough for a quick drink or a look around. The street outside is known for its after-dark buzz, so it’s worth noting if you prefer a calmer scene.
San Jac Saloon
Your final stop is a historic bar co-owned by a star of the TV series “Supernatural,” which adds a fun pop culture element. Modern amenities meet old-world charm in this building, and you can sample some of Austin’s best craft beers. The 20-minute stop is perfect to wrap up your spooky night, and many reviews mention the knowledgeable guides and the storytelling that makes these bars come alive.
What’s Included and What’s Not
For $27, the tour covers a professional, friendly guide and detailed, accurate ghost stories that truly add depth to each location. The stories are authentic and locally researched, ensuring you’re not just getting canned tales. You’ll also have plenty of time to purchase your own drinks, making it a flexible, social experience.
However, it’s important to note that transportation and alcoholic beverages are not included. You’ll meet at The Driskill Bar and end there too, so plan your transportation accordingly. If you’re coming from farther out or using public transit, check nearby stops; the tour is near public transportation options.
Group Size and Timing
With a maximum of 20 travelers, the tour maintains a cozy, intimate feel — ideal for conversation and personalized storytelling. The tour starts at 6:00 pm, giving you the perfect early evening window to enjoy some cooler night air and avoid the late-night rush.
